Benefits of Off-Peak Season Solar Pergola Installations
Savvy homeowners often prioritize solar installations during the off-peak season, typically the cooler months when demand for installation services might be lower. This strategic timing can lead to several advantages. Contractors may have greater availability, potentially offering more flexible scheduling and even reduced pricing due to less competitive demand. The installation process itself can also be more comfortable for workers without the intense heat of summer, potentially leading to a smoother and more efficient project completion. Planning an installation during this period allows for the system to be fully operational and ready to maximize energy production when the peak sunlight hours of spring and summer arrive.

When considering the investment in a solar pergola, understanding the potential costs is a crucial step. Prices can vary significantly based on the size of the pergola, the type and efficiency of the solar panels, the complexity of the installation, and whether it’s a DIY kit or a professionally installed custom build. General estimates for a solar pergola installation in the United States can range from a few thousand dollars for smaller, simpler kits to upwards of $20,000 for larger, custom-designed systems with high-efficiency panels and integrated battery storage. It’s advisable to obtain multiple quotes from local providers to get a precise understanding of costs for your specific needs.
| Product/Service Category | Provider Type | Cost Estimation (USD) |
|---|---|---|
| Small Solar Pergola (DIY Kit) | Online Retailers, Hardware Stores | $3,000 - $7,000 |
| Medium Solar Pergola (Standard Installation) | Local Solar Installers, Landscaping Companies | $8,000 - $15,000 |
| Large Custom Solar Pergola (Integrated System) | Specialized Solar & Outdoor Living Firms | $15,000 - $30,000+ |
Prices, rates, or cost estimates mentioned in this article are based on the latest available information but may change over time. Independent research is advised before making financial decisions.
